What was the cause of the witch trial hysteria in 1692

History
1 answer:
TEA [102]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

in Salem Village, Massachusetts, a group of young girls claimed to be possessed and accused several local women of witchcraft.

when president cleveland tried to restore the queen to power, hawaii's leaders refused. why do you think they did this? what eco
makvit [3.9K]

Answer:

People like Sanford Dole needed the island to be part of the United States to ensure their entrance to American sugar markets.

Explanation:

Hawaii was a kingdom until 1893 when American planters established corp to overthrow Queen Liliuokalani. Hawaii became a republic in 1894. In 1840, a constitutional monarchy was established, stripping the Hawaiian monarch authority. The economic reasons have contributed to the overthrow of the Queen from power. American planters generated money in Hawaii through sugar plantations. Sugar exports to the United States expanded greatly over the period, and American investors and sugar planters on the islands increased their domination over affairs to establish their control over the people in Hawaii.
